KathmanduTwo hydropower workers survived nine days underground.
Roughly 900 more remain trapped in tunnels along Nepal’s Trishuli River.
An upstream glacier collapse sent ice, rock and mud down river valleys packed with hydropower tunnels.
Rescuers keep digging as Nepal’s disaster agency counts more than 5,000 still missing.
